The micro injection molded plastic market was valued at US$ 1.29 billion in 2025 and is projected to reach US$ 3.84 billion by 2034, registering a CAGR of 14.56% during 2026–2034.  As healthcare and technology sectors prioritize lightweight, high-precision components, high-performance engineering thermoplastics—such as polyether ether ketone (PEEK), liquid crystal polymers (LCP), polycarbonate (PC), and polyoxymethylene (POM)—are increasingly processed into micro-sized parts. These micro-molded components serve essential roles in drug delivery devices, catheter tips, surgical implants, microfluidic biochips, hearing aid enclosures, and automotive electronic connectors. Advanced micro-tooling, cleanroom manufacturing, and automated vision inspection systems continue to enable molders to achieve exceptional repeatability and lower unit production costs at high volumes.

Key Market Report Drivers

  • Surging Demand for Minimally Invasive Surgical Instruments and Medical Implants: The healthcare industry’s transition toward minimally invasive surgery, wearable drug delivery pods, and point-of-care microfluidic diagnostics creates an acute need for sub-millimeter plastic components with biocompatible materials.

  • Electronics Miniaturization and Micro-Optics Expansion: Consumer electronics, wearable gadgets, and fiber optic telecommunications require microscopic connectors, switches, micro-lenses, and sensor housings that demand extreme dimensional accuracy and thermal stability.

  • Electrification and Autonomous Features in Automotive Systems: Modern electric vehicles (EVs) and advanced driver assistance systems (ADAS) rely on tiny plastic connectors, fuel-injection micro-parts, camera module housings, and internal sensor enclosures.

  • Material Innovations in High-Performance Engineering Polymers: Breakthroughs in bio-stable PEEK, LCP, and ultra-high-molecular-weight polymers allow micro-molded components to replace delicate metal alloys, reducing weight while delivering chemical inertness and structural integrity.

What primary polymer materials are used in micro injection molding?

Primary materials include Liquid Crystal Polymers (LCP), Polyether Ether Ketone (PEEK), Polycarbonate (PC), Polyethylene (PE), Polyoxymethylene (POM), and Polyetherimide (PEI).

Which key end-use applications generate the highest demand for micro injection molded plastics?

Medical devices and diagnostic equipment represent the largest demand segment, followed closely by automotive electronics, micro-optics, and consumer electronics.
